After retiring from professional football in ...Feb 9, 2024 · Which Year Did Terry Crews Play in the NFL? The “Everybody Hates Chris” actor had a short NFL journey that started in 1991 with the Rams. After being released, he spent 1992 as a free agent. He spent the 1993 off-season on the Packers‘ practice squad and the regular season with the Chargers. Terry Crews played for three NFL teams. He was in the camp for a fourth team, but did not make the final roster. Los Angeles Rams (1991) San Diego Chargers (1993) Washington Redskins (1995) Philadelphia Eagles (1996) - did not make final roster. , During the May 31 episode of "Sherri," former NFL linebacker and current "America's Got Talent" host Terry Crews showed Shepherd how to tackle.
